What does going over the top mean?

Going over the top is when soldiers were forced to run over the top of the trenches in which they were fighting from and walk out on to the battlefield to gain vital land in the war. hundreds of people would die while traveling through no man's land.

What was the turning point in north Africa during world war 2?

Germanys main idea was to dominate Europe. After Italy joined Germany, they wanted to continue their empire further down and Italian troops were instucted to take over Northen Africa. Australian troops had been sent to the Middle East early in 1941. They were very successful in defeating Italian troops at Benghazi, and Vichy French forces in Syria. The biggest test came against the German troops who were trying to take the port of Tobruk, a strategically important area.
